During the football season, Tomas Öhman is in the clubhouse at Höganäs sports center almost every day.

There he washes, presents clothes to the players before their training sessions and matches, and arranges balls and cones.

- I am the first man here and the last to go, he says.

Has been materialist for 20 years

Tomas Öhman's love for Höganäs BK began as early as 1975 when he started playing football at the age of seven.

As a 16-year-old, he stopped playing and instead became a youth leader.

Now he is the club's materials manager - something he has been for 20 years.

- The club means everything to me.

I would never be able to go to another club, he says.

Has been awarded a prize

Tomas Öhman has now been awarded an award, Wasilioff's memory, for his involvement in the club.

- I was not prepared for this.

It's great fun and I feel honored, he says.

Filip Wasilioff was Höganäs BK's first chairman when the club was formed in 1913. The award was established in 2013 and goes to people who have made extraordinary contributions for a long time for the club.

- Tomas is invaluable to Höganäs BK.

He is always here and prepares for matches and so on.

It is such a housewife that everyone wants, says Bengt Thorn, club chairman.
